Prognozy pogody nowej generacji
WeatherNextGen to eksperymentalny zbiór danych globalnych prognoz pogody średnioterminowej, które są tworzone przez operacyjną wersję modelu pogody opartej na dyfuzji opracowanego przez Google DeepMind. Zbiór danych eksperymentalnych obejmuje dane historyczne i w czasie rzeczywistym. Prognozy na wykresie w aplikacji WeatherNext
WeatherNext Graph to eksperymentalny zbiór danych globalnych prognoz pogody średnioterminowych, które są tworzone przez operacyjną wersję graficznego modelu pogody sieci neuronowej Google DeepMind. Zbiór danych eksperymentalnych obejmuje dane historyczne i w czasie rzeczywistym.
